WebJul 26, 2024 · These molecules can undergo a reversible trans - and cis-isomerization induced by illumination (Figure 1a). For the most common azobenzene molecules, ultraviolet light irradiation induces the isomerization from trans-to-cis, while the reverse takes place via thermal relaxations or upon irradiation by visible light.
